13/7/2024 12:25 | HT - re post 136036 and the Morningstar link. I don't think this is going to improve our lot. The "UK will move to a "disclosure-based" system, which the FCA hopes will "put sufficient information in the hands of investors, so they can influence company behaviour and decide how they want to invest." actually seems a backward step. The article goes on to state "The existing regime means corporate actions are put to mandatory votes, long seen as a key feature of the UK's global reputation for corporate governance. However, the FCA agrees they can also present stumbling blocks. Instead, "significant transactions" and "related-party" transactions will now be subject to official disclosures to allow investors to make up their own minds in a different way. Shareholder approval for reverse takeovers and de-listing will remain." So this seems to be a move from requiring shareholder approval for significant and related party transactions to one where the the BoD just tell them what is happening. I really don't think that is going to make things better here, in fact, it'll probably make things far worse in terms of shareholder engagement. Further on the article quotes "Chris Beckett, head of equity research at Quilter Cheviot, agreed the reforms were an important move, but highlighted the risk that governance standards might fall." | ![]() only1gibbo | |
